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"welcome guys" in informal settings when addressing a group of men or a mixed-gender group you are comfortable addressing informally. It's a friendly way to start a conversation or presentation.
Common error
In professional or academic environments, using "welcome guys" can sound unprofessional. Opt for more formal greetings such as "welcome everyone" or "welcome colleagues".

How can I use "welcome guys" in a sentence?
You can use "welcome guys" to greet a group of people informally, such as "Welcome guys, glad to have you here!" or "Welcome guys, let's get started."
Is "welcome guys" appropriate in a professional setting?
In more formal environments, it's better to use alternatives like "welcome everyone" or "welcome colleagues" to maintain a professional tone.
What is the difference between "welcome guys" and "welcome everyone"?
"Welcome guys" is more informal and typically used to address a group of men or a mixed-gender group in a casual setting. "Welcome everyone" is more inclusive and suitable for diverse audiences and formal situations.
What can I say instead of "welcome guys"?
Depending on the context, you can use alternatives like "hi everyone", "hello everyone", "welcome folks", or "welcome friends".
